A body of mass M at rest explodes into three pieces, two of which of mass M//4 each are thrown off in prependicular directions eith velocities of `3//s` and `4m//s` respectively. The third piece willl be thrown off with a velocity of

A

`1.5" m"//"s"`

B

`2.0" m"//"s"`

C

`2.5" m"//"s"`

D

`3.0" m"//"s"`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C
